ArcVane objects shape light through printed form, surface, and clearance. The lamp holder, base or fitting, and bulb are selected separately, so the best result comes from treating fit, heat, and scale as part of the same decision.
Current ArcVane shades and shade-and-stand objects are designed around compatible E27 lamp holders and stable compliant lamp bases or fittings sourced separately by the customer.
Use modern low-heat E27 LED bulbs only. Do not use incandescent, halogen, heat lamp, appliance, or other high-temperature bulb types.
Choose bulbs that sit comfortably inside the shade profile with air space around the bulb, neck, and opening. As a practical starting point, compact E27 LEDs around 45–60 mm wide and 80–110 mm tall are usually easier to fit than oversized feature bulbs.
Leave visible clearance between the bulb and PLA surfaces. If a bulb runs hot to the touch, crowds the shade, or touches any printed surface, choose a smaller and lower-heat LED before use.
ArcVane supplies
Decorative shades, decorative lighting forms, stands, diffusers, mechanical adapters, and modular lighting accessories, as stated on each product page.
Customer supplies
Compatible E27 lamp holder, low-heat E27 LED bulb, and stable compliant lamp base or customer-supplied fitting. The customer also supplies any electrical socket, cord, plug, switch, and wiring required for that fitting.
ArcVane does not currently supply
Bulbs, electrical sockets, cords, plugs, lamp holders, wiring, complete lamp bases, or electrical assemblies unless a future product page explicitly states otherwise.
Review the product page for supplied ArcVane components, dimensions, adapter notes, and clearance language. If you are matching an existing E27 lamp holder or base, confirm the holder neck, bulb envelope, shade opening, and airflow before purchase.
